Zambia Holds International Trade Fair With Over 800 Exhibitors

Date:

 

By Mulenga Banda, Lusaka

More than 800 local and international Exhibitors from various sectors of the economy are participating in this year’s Zambian International Trade Fair

With the theme ” Promoting Value Addition For Sustainable Growth, the Fair is being held in Ndolla on the Copperbelt

Speaking at the Fair, President Hakainde Hichilema who is also the Patron of the Fair, commended the organisers for chosen the appropriate theme for the event adding that Zambia is back and opened for business.

“We officiated at this year’s 56th Zambia International Trade Fair (ZITF) in Ndola on the Copperbelt whose theme is “Promoting Value Addition for Sustainable Growth”.

“The ZITF is the biggest trade exhibition in Zambia and has this year seen more than 800 local and international exhibitors from various sectors of our economy.

“As patron for the ZITF, we thank the organisers for the appropriate theme that perfectly resonates with our economic transformation agenda of value addition focusing on processing our local products into finished goods which will create more jobs.

“Copperbelt is particularly special for us as it houses the material that will feed our batteries for electric motor vehicles following the MOU we signed with DRC.

”We shall continue exploring ways of improving the business environment especially the cost of doing business.

“Zambia is back and open for business,”
